Bones are the framework that supports the whole human body to stand, walk, run and so on, and strong bones can effectively resist the damage of various external factors.
Bone density is one of the important factors affecting bone strength, and the bone density of human beings gradually changes in the process of moving from ape to upright walking, and the density of bones decreases a lot.
The human body can increase bone density after exercise, but this kind of exercise is not exercise in the conventional sense, and the exercise here can actually be understood as the fracture and growth of bones.
Bone cells rebuild where bones were broken, and new, denser bone grows in places where there were no bones.
Relying on external forces to continuously force the bone micro-bone cracks, healing, and then bone cracks to heal again, and so on many times can gradually increase the overall strength of the bones.
Muay Thai fighters are said to use this method to make the bones of the limbs crack slightly and then increase the mechanical strength of the bones!

The last one is graphene, which is known as the king of materials, and is the strongest material, the thinnest thickness, and the hardest known material in the world!
And it's very stable, 100 times stronger than the best steel in the world, and harder than diamond.
If graphene, which is as thick as 1/100,000 of the diameter of a human hair, is folded into plastic wrap, it would take the pressure generated by an elephant standing on a pencil to puncture it!
It is resistant to both high and low temperatures, and can maintain high strength in the temperature range of -253°C~500°C. Beyond this range, the intensity decreases, but it still performs very well.
Ultra-thin: a single atomic layer, 0.35 nanometers, equivalent to 1/200,000 in the diameter of a hair.
Super dense: even the smallest gas atoms (helium atoms) cannot penetrate.
Super conductivity: electrons travel at speeds close to 1000 km/s.
Ultra-high light transmittance: The light transmittance of a single layer of graphene reaches 97.7%, which is almost transparent.
Ultra-high hardness and toughness: it can be bent at will, and if it is made into a packaging bag with the thickness of an ordinary plastic bag, it can bear a weight of about two tons.
Ultra-high thermal conductivity: It is the material with the highest known thermal conductivity.
Large proportional surface area: the specific surface area of a single layer of graphene can reach 2630 square meters/g,
